Adaptation | Adaptation Planning Process | 3.5 | Please explain how your city has addressed vulnerable groups through transformative action. | 0 | 0 | In 2020, Council received State and Federal Government funding to build resilience and recovery from the bushfires. The funding was used for various projects, but one component was to establish a designated Disaster Resilience Officer who would be the spokesperson for the community. As part of this funding a working group was established with key community members and an officer from a neighbouring LGA, to work through and implement programs to mitigate climate risk. This group will receive upskilling and training opportunities in the near future to improve emergency management and psychological first aid skills. Council's Disaster Resilience Officer has also consulted with various community organisations regarding vulnerable community groups, to ensure that these members of the community are engaged with on climate risks. Community representatives in isolated communities were established as conduits for information during an emergency, as well as plans for street meets around the Shire to build neighbourhood networks and connection. This will help ensure elderly or vulnerable residents are taken into account during an emergency. In 2021, Council will host a number of workshops to engage the community, particularly vulnerable, isolated, and indigenous members, and build education and awareness around climate risks for better resilience. An on-ground homelessness survey also took place earlier in 2021 to assess this vulnerable community, involving in-person conversations and assessments. Various homelessness programs have been developed by Council to improve this issue in the Shire, including two designated Officers to implement these programs and liaise with this group. | 01/20/2022 02:27:05 | ||||

Description
This data is collected through the CDP-ICLEI Unified Reporting System. When using this data, please cite both organisations using the following wording: ‘This data was collected in partnership by CDP and ICLEI - Local Governments for Sustainability’.
This dataset contains a subset of the related full cities dataset, covering Climate Risk and Vulnerability Assessment and Adaptation Action questions for publicly disclosing cities in 2021. The platform is still open and the dataset is updated daily to reflect new submissions.
To view the cities 2021 questionnaire guidance, including all questions asked to cities in 2021, visit https://www.cdp.net/en/guidance/guidance-for-cities.
For any questions, including guidance on how to reference this data in your own work, please contact cities@cdp.net.
Please note that this dataset may contain data from cities or, in some instances, groups of cities at different administrative levels. This includes metropolitan areas, combined authorities, and some regional councils.
When using the inventory data for aggregation, comparison and trend analysis, please note that the inventory data is based on non-verified self-reported city inputs. The reported inventory may not include all emission sources within the city boundary.
